Transaction 743351143a2e9a12590d21a34b025add387f2a64b1ce2399c04ad17f5c4e70da

1 Input
2 Outputs
  • 743351143a2e9a12590d21a34b025add387f2a64b1ce2399c04ad17f5c4e70da:0
  • value  14352
    address  357d4rAjQhDPaWhZrBAFY7aizVPkNSq2DH
  • 743351143a2e9a12590d21a34b025add387f2a64b1ce2399c04ad17f5c4e70da:1
  • value  269717
    address  3KSuCpZ2zNXfQNjZ7bXbRTtKSUeQdHzxcx